    I'd agree. The lump is a 3.2 from a 328 with 355 throttle bodies. As best I know the increase in performance must be pretty good, the V6 putting out 192 bhp, and V8, 270. Though I'd appreciate that, I'd not delay getting the car onto 'correct' colour Cromodoras!

    Here's an unusual one, photographed last week at Lydden - a Tornado Talisman, (I'd never previously seen one):
    upload_2019-6-7_11-26-40.png
    Bill Woodhouse and Tony Bullen founded Tornado around 1958 and started building cars in Chipperfield, and then Rickmansworth, Herts, England. Initially, this was a model known as the Typhoon, based on the Ford 10. About 300 of these were sold and this enabled consolidation of the company and, from 1960, expansion with new models, Thunderbolt, Tempest Sport (Brake) and Talisman. However, following a change of company ownership, production ceased in 1964. See also: https://web.archive.org/web/2005102...uc.s.easynet.co.uk/tornado_register/photo.htm
